SaberCats top Destroyers in Arena Bowl XXI

Filed under: Arena Bowl, Columbus Destroyers, Ohio Football — @ 4:50 pm

The San Jose SaberCats proved why they were the favorites in Arena Bowl XXI today as their precision offense could not be stopped by the Columbus Destroyers’ defense. Scoring 8 TDsin 9 possessions behind QB Matt Grieb, the SaberCats won their 3rd Arena Bowl Championship in 6 years in defeating the Columbus Destroyers by a score of 55-33. With the 3 Arena Bowl Championships, the SaberCats now site in 3rd place for all-time Arena Football League Arena Bowl Championship.
